This researcher focuses on dairy food science, particularly the composition and health effects of milk fat globule membrane (MFGM) and milk phospholipids. Work spans extracting and characterizing these dairy components, studying how they interact with proteins and bacteria, and testing their effects on gut health and metabolic markers in both lab settings and human clinical trials. The research bridges food processing engineering with nutrition and microbiology.
